A history of Britain's open-top buses.

This illustrated history charts the development of the open-top bus, from the early 1900s when buses were built with no roofs to the bustling sightseeing operations so popular around the world today, recalling many operators along the way who have since been relegated to the annals of history.

Following the trends around the UK, from London and the south coast to the north and Scotland, bus enthusiast and author Philip C. Miles has collated many unusual photographs showing these buses at work. Detailing the bus and the operator concerned in each photograph and including an extensive colour section, this book also considers the role of the open-top bus today.
